Chargement...
Chargement...

Ingénierie de la spécialisation de programmes. Vol. 2. Techniques avancées

Auteur : Renaud Marlet

85,00 €
Chargement...
Livraison à partir de 0,01 €
-5 % Retrait en magasin avec la carte Mollat
en savoir plus
0,00 €
Protection:
Acheter en numérique

Résumé

L'évaluation partielle, ou spécialisation de programmes, permet de rendre les programmes plus petits et plus rapides lorsque certaines entrées peuvent être connues à l'avance. L'ouvrage détaille diverses analyses de programmes et s'intéresse aux programmes incomplets, aux sous-programmes spécialisés, à la spécialisation incrémentale ou de données. ©Electre 2024

La spécialisation de programmes, aussi appelée évaluation partielle, est une technique générale destinée à rendre les programmes plus performants (plus rapides et possiblement plus petits) quand certaines entrées peuvent être connues à l'avance. Du point de vue du génie logiciel, la spécialisation facilite aussi grandement l'écriture des programmes et leur maintenance. Cet ouvrage, conçu à la fois pour les chercheurs et les ingénieurs logiciels, tant architectes que développeurs, en fait une large présentation pratique.

Ce volume détaille une gamme étendue de précisions d'analyses de programmes, qui sont déterminantes sur le degré de spécialisation. Il étudie également les questions de réification et de spécialisation de programmes incomplets, d'ordinaire peu traitées mais pourtant capitales, et explore diverses manières efficaces d'exploiter un sous-programme spécialisé. Il décrit aussi la spécialisation incrémentale, notamment à l'exécution, et présente une puissante technique alternative de spécialisation, la spécialisation de données. Il apporte des perspectives scientifiques et industrielles.

Fiche Technique

ISBN : 978-2-7462-3799-5

EAN13 : 9782746237995

Reliure : Broché

Pages : 343

Hauteur: 24.0 cm / Largeur 16.0 cm


Épaisseur: 1.8 cm

Poids: 530 g